Conformance status

The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) defines requirements for designers and developers to improve accessibility for people with disabilities. It defines three levels of conformance: Level A, Level AA, and Level AAA. EXi is non conformant with WCAG 2.1 level AA. Non conformant means that the product does not conform to the accessibility standard.

Additional accessibility considerations

Although our apps do leverage some of the built in assistive technologies provided by Apple’s iOS (Apple Accessibility Technologies) and Google’s Android Operating System (Android Accessibility), the apps are not yet fully conformant.  
 

The CMS web portal and the EXi website currently provide a responsive experience, run on multiple browsers and platforms but are not yet fully compliant.
 

Ultimately our goal is to achieve a high level of WCAG 2.1 conformance and provide accessibility features that address the four main categories of disabilities: VisionHearingPhysical and MotorLiteracy and Learning.
